Banco debadell Common Stock Calculation

Common stock is listed on the Balance Sheet at the par value of the total shares outstanding of a company.

The par value of common stocks is meaningless. It is usually set at an absurdly low number.

Banco debadell Business Description

Address Placa de Sant Roc no. 20, Sabadell, Alicante, ESP, 08201
Banco de Sabadell SA is a Spanish retail and commercial bank operating mostly in Spain but with a notable lending presence in the United Kingdom and the Americas. It emphasizes scaling its current customer base and laying the foundation for international expansion. Its business line is commercial banking, which focuses on providing financial products and services to large corporations, small to medium-sized enterprises, retailers and sole proprietors, professional groupings, entrepreneurs, and personal customers. Loans and advances constitute a majority of the bank's earning assets. Its credit risk is mostly exposed to mortgage loans, followed by sovereign debt.
